Description
In the second volume of this captivating series, readers are drawn deeper into a surreal landscape where dreams and reality intertwine. Simon Spurrier weaves a narrative that is both intricate and thought-provoking, exploring the complexities of human emotion through the lens of the dream realm. The characters, already rich with backstory from the previous volume, face new challenges that test their resolve and redefine their identities.
Bilquis Evely’s stunning illustrations enhance the experience, bringing the dreamscapes to life with vibrant imagery and remarkable detail. Each page invites readers to lose themselves in a world where the subconscious dominates and the boundaries of reality blur. The artistry captures the essence of every character’s journey, illustrating both their inner conflicts and the external forces that shape them.
As the plot unfolds, themes of loss, desire, and existential exploration are brought to the forefront, making for a compelling commentary on the human experience. The characters grapple with their fears and aspirations, navigating a labyrinth of emotions that resonates deeply with readers.
Abigail Larson's contributions further enrich the narrative, providing a haunting yet beautiful depth that lingers long after the last page is turned. In this volume, the exploration of the dream realm becomes more poignant and darker, setting the stage for a captivating continuation of the series.
